tailieunhanh - Phát triển Android khi sử dụng Eclipse và các widget của Android (kỳ 1)

Tóm tắt: Hướng dẫn này dành cho bất cứ ai quan tâm đến việc bắt đầu phát triển Android trên Eclipse bằng cách sử dụng trình cắm thêm (plug-in) các công cụ phát triển Android (ADT). Hướng dẫn này mang đến cái nhìn thấu đáo về các tính năng nổi bật của một ứng dụng Android, cùng với lời giải thích ngắn gọn về các thành phần cơ bản của nó. | Phát triên Android khi sử dụng Eclipse và các widget của Android kỳ 1 Tóm tắt Hướng dẫn này dành cho bất cứ ai quan tâm đến việc bắt đầu phát triển Android trên Eclipse bằng cách sử dụng trình cắm thêm plug-in các công cụ phát triển Android ADT . Hướng dẫn này mang đến cái nhìn thấu đáo về các tính năng nổi bật của một ứng dụng Android cùng với lời giải thích ngắn gọn về các thành phần cơ bản của nó. Quá trình Android được giới thiệu để phát triển các Giao diện người dùng UI phong phú cho các ứng dụng như các widget tiện ích . Cuối cùng nó giới thiệu một cách dễ dàng để kiểm thử các ứng dụng đã phát triển bằng cách triển khai ứng dụng đó trên một trình mô phỏng thiết bị Android có kèm trong bộ công cụ phát triển phần mềm SDK . Mở đầu Android là một hệ điều hành di động tương tự như Symbian iOS Windows Mobile và những hệ điều hành khác. Ban đầu Android do công ty Android Inc. phát triển về sau Google đã mua lại công ty này. Android bây giờ thuộc quyền sở hữu của Open Handset Alliance Liên minh mở về thiết bị cầm tay và hoàn toàn là nguồn mở đó là lý do làm nó ngày càng phổ biến. Google đã phát hành hầu hết các mã Android theo Giấy phép của Apache. Với giấy phép này các nhà cung cấp có thể thêm phần mở rộng độc quyền mà không cần đệ trình chúng lại cho cộng đồng nguồn mở. Nhiều phiên bản Android đã ra thị trường kể từ lúc khởi đầu gần đây nhất là quý 3 năm 2010 bao gồm power-packed Froyo Froyo được đóng gói mạnh phiên bản . Android đã vượt ra ngoài không còn chỉ là một nền tảng cho các thiết bị di động hệ thống truyền hình mới của Google cũng chạy trên Android. Android sử dụng một nhân kernel Linux đã cải biên và cho phép ứng dụng được phát triển bằng công nghệ Java sử dụng các thư viện Java một số trong các thư viện đó được Google phát triển cho Android . Mặc dù các ứng dụng Android được viết bằng ngôn ngữ Java không có Máy ảo Java Java Virtual Machine nào chạy trong nền tảng này và mã byte Java không được thi hành ở đây. Các lớp Java được biên dịch lại thành .